VirtualizingStackPanel.SetIsVirtualizing(DependencyObject, Boolean) Methode
Definitie
Belangrijk
Bepaalde informatie heeft betrekking op een voorlopige productversie die aanzienlijk kan worden gewijzigd voordat deze wordt uitgebracht. Microsoft biedt geen enkele expliciete of impliciete garanties met betrekking tot de informatie die hier wordt verstrekt.
Hiermee stelt u de waarde van de IsVirtualizingProperty gekoppelde eigenschap in.
public:
static void SetIsVirtualizing(System::Windows::DependencyObject ^ element, bool value);
public static void SetIsVirtualizing(System.Windows.DependencyObject element, bool value);
static member SetIsVirtualizing : System.Windows.DependencyObject * bool -> unit
Public Shared Sub SetIsVirtualizing (element As DependencyObject, value As Boolean)
Parameters
- element
- DependencyObject
Het object waaraan de waarde van de gekoppelde eigenschap is ingesteld.
- value
- Boolean
trueals het VirtualizingStackPanel is gevirtualiseerd; anders. false
Opmerkingen
Het standaardindelingssysteem maakt itemcontainers en berekent de indeling voor elk item dat is gekoppeld aan een lijstbesturing. Het woord 'virtualize' verwijst naar een techniek waarmee een subset van UI-elementen wordt gegenereerd op basis van een groter aantal gegevensitems op basis waarvan items zichtbaar zijn op het scherm. Het genereren van veel UI-elementen wanneer er slechts een paar elementen op het scherm kunnen zijn, kan de prestaties van uw toepassing nadelig beïnvloeden. Hiermee VirtualizingStackPanel berekent u het aantal zichtbare items en werkt u met de ItemContainerGenerator elementen van een ItemsControl (zoals ListBox of ListView) om alleen ui-elementen te maken voor zichtbare items.